Output caff59edae2775d1de3119345b23d95c46c41b50a2f5e54f0b2efd0a1091f9f6:0

value
9042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 964426cb98921991904ed71b432aba593a45a790 OP_EQUAL
address
3FPYva3owmHjywa8Z16stbDu3Bk3TzrotK
transaction
caff59edae2775d1de3119345b23d95c46c41b50a2f5e54f0b2efd0a1091f9f6